会泽黄草岭磷矿地质特征及成矿浅析

摘    要:会泽县黄草岭磷矿含矿层位为下寒武统渔户村组中谊村段(∈1yz),胶磷矿由砂屑、砾屑、鲕粒组成,孔隙一基底胶结,多伴铁泥质胶结,颗粒形态次圆、不规则状,细、粗颗粒含量不均;沉积环境处于古陆边缘浅海地域,矿物质来源主要取决于古陆风化淋滤作用.
